Descending Colon
Part of the colon extending from the left colonic flexure to the sigmoid colon.
Ascending Colon
The first main part of the large intestine, which absorbs water and salts as it carries waste upward from the cecum toward the transverse colon.
Gallbladder
A tiny organ situated beneath the liver, responsible for storing and concentrating bile, which is a digestive liquid created by the liver.
Bile
Fluid secreted from the liver into the duodenum; consists of bile salts, bile pigments, bicarbonate ions, cholesterol, fats, fat-soluble hormones, and lecithin.
